Heim > Web-Frontend > Front-End-Fragen und Antworten > Worin ist JavaScript unterteilt?

Worin ist JavaScript unterteilt?

WBOY
Freigeben: 2022-02-08 14:52:48
Original
2375 Leute haben es durchsucht

JavaScript kann in drei Teile unterteilt werden: Kern (ECMAScript), Dokumentobjektmodell (DOM) und Browserobjektmodell (BOM); diese drei Teile beschreiben jeweils die JavaScript-Syntax und grundlegende Objekte, Methoden und Schnittstellen für die Verarbeitung von Webinhalten und -methoden Schnittstellen zur Interaktion mit dem Browser.

Worin ist JavaScript unterteilt?

Die Betriebsumgebung dieses Tutorials: Windows 10-System, JavaScript-Version 1.8.5, Dell G3-Computer.

In was ist JavaScript unterteilt?

JavaScript besteht aus drei Teilen. Sie sind Core (ECMAScript), Document Object Model (DOM) und Browser Object Model (BOM). Diese drei Teile beschreiben die Syntax und die grundlegenden Objekte der Sprache, Methoden und Schnittstellen zur Verarbeitung von Webinhalten sowie Methoden und Schnittstellen zur Interaktion mit Browsern.

1. ECMAScript (Kern)

Hinweis:

1 Der Browser ist nur eine der Hostumgebungen für die ECMAScript-Implementierung.

2 Grundlagen, wie zum Beispiel einige Syntax, Typen, Anweisungen, Schlüsselwörter, reservierte Wörter, Operatoren, Objekte...

3 Die Host-Umgebung stellt die grundlegende Implementierung und Erweiterung der Sprache bereit, wie zum Beispiel DOM

4

Knoten: serverseitige JavaScript-Plattform

Adobe Flash

2. DOM (Document Object Model)

1. Funktion

(1) Ordnen Sie die gesamte Seite einer mehrschichtigen Knotenstruktur zu

(2) und stellen Sie dann eine Reihe dieser Methoden zum Hinzufügen, Löschen, Ändern und Überprüfen von Knoten (Inhalt) bereit.

2. DOM-Ebene und Methoden für HTML

(2)DOM2

Erweiterte Maus- und Benutzeroberflächenereignisse, Bereichs-, Traversal- und andere Unterteilungsmodule sowie Unterstützung für CSS über die Objektschnittstelle.

Die Details sind wie folgt:

DOM-Ansicht: Definiert die Schnittstelle zum Verfolgen verschiedener Dokumentansichten

DOM-Ereignisse: Definiert die Schnittstelle für Ereignisse und Ereignisverarbeitung

DOM-Stil: Definiert die Schnittstelle für Bedienelementstile basierend auf CSS

DOM-Traversal und -Bereich: a. Definiert die Schnittstelle zum Durchlaufen und Bedienen des Dokumentbaums. b Fügt eine neue Methode zum Überprüfen des Dokuments hinzu. (3) DOM3

führt eine Methode zum einheitlichen Laden und Speichern von Dokumenten ein 3. Hinweis

für Basierend auf XML, aber erweitert, die Anwendungsprogrammierschnittstelle (API) für HTML, nicht nur für JavaScript, viele andere Sprachen implementieren auch DOM.

Guangzhou Brand Design Company https://www.houdianzi.com PPT-Vorlagen-Download-Sammlung https://redbox.wode007.com

Three.BOM (Browser Object Model)

1. Funktion

Verarbeitung des Browsers Fenster und Frames

js-Erweiterung für Browseroperationen

2. Spezifische Funktionen

Die Funktion zum Öffnen eines neuen Browserfensters

Die Funktion zum Verschieben, Zoomen und Schließen des Browserfensters

Ein Navigator, der detaillierte Informationen zum Browser bereitstellt

Das Standortobjekt, das detaillierte Informationen über die vom Browser geladene Seite bereitstellt.

Das Bildschirmobjekt, das detaillierte Informationen über die Monitorauflösung des Benutzers bereitstellt.

Unterstützung für Cookies

Das obige ist der detaillierte Inhalt vonWorin ist JavaScript unterteilt?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age